Experiment #2: Physical Properties of Matter
Objective:
To distinguish between intensive and extensive properties of matter.
Materials:
2 long candles (diameter of about 1.5 cm) Sharp Razor Blade
3 iron nails of different sizes Ruler
2 graduated cylinder (10 mL and 100 mL) 1 pc. of sitaw
Triple Beam Balance Graphing Paper
Procedure:
A.
1. Cut the candle into 3 parts of different lengths.
2. Measure the length of each in centimeters using ruler.
3. Determine the mass of each candle piece using triple beam balance.
4. Determine the volume of each by water displacement using the 100-mL graduated
cylinder. See to it that the entire candle is under water. If the candle floats, push it
down using a sitaw.
5. Record your observation in Table I.
6. Find the density using this formula:
M Whereas: M = mass (g)
D = ---------- V = volume (mL)
V D = density (g/mL)
7. Get the Average Density for the candle.
B. Repeat procedure A from 2-7 using iron nails of different sizes instead candles. Use 10-mL
cylinder for this. The length of the nails must not more than 7 cm.
